996,222 (nine hundred ninety-six thousand two hundred twenty-two)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 23 × 7,219. Its proper divisors sum to 1,083,138,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xF337E.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 996222, here are decompositions:

  • 11 + 996211 = 996222
  • 13 + 996209 = 996222
  • 53 + 996169 = 996222
  • 61 + 996161 = 996222
  • 79 + 996143 = 996222
  • 103 + 996119 = 996222
  • 113 + 996109 = 996222
  • 173 + 996049 = 996222

Showing the first eight; more decompositions exist.
